LRT system resumes full service

By Anil Jhalli

The general manager (GM) of Ottawa's transit services has revealed that all repairs are complete to the O-Train Line 1 overhead catenary system. 

A section of the LRT line's overhead catenary system was damaged between the University of Ottawa (uOttawa) and Lees station during a storm that happened on Sunday, July 24. 

In a memo to Ottawa city councillors released on Friday, July 29, OC Transpo GM Renée Amilcar said damage from the storm has been repaired, and testing has been completed. 

The system is resuming full service and 11 trains are planned to run during the afternoon peak period. 

“We recognize the impacts these disruptions have had on our customers, and we thank them for their continued patience as we worked with Rideau Transit Group (RTG) to resolve the issues and return to normal operations,” the memo said. “We want to reassure our customers that the system is safe.”

RTG continues with its investigation into the system damage from July 24.
